p.1 #4 · Burlington, Iowa Eagles anyone?


I was in Dubuque this past Sunday. Water is completely frozen below the Lock and Dam. I only saw one far away. Last year this place had open water and full of eagles. There is quite bit of open water at the Lock and Dam in Bellevue. However there is fence that is 5-6 feet tall between the park and the river.Pull a picknick table near the fence and setup the tripod there. I counted 60 to 70 eagles. Again Eagles were further away compared to last year. keokuk had there Eagle days this past Sunday.

p.1 #6 · Burlington, Iowa Eagles anyone?


I'm not sure what post your referring too but:

Under the Bridge in Burlington on the Iowa side is Big Muddy's > they have been spotted there.

Down South near Keokuk along the River is a Great place and every year they a Bald Eagle Days and there are good numbers there.

North near Dubuque at any of the lock and damns is usually pretty good.

I'm in California so not sure what the weather has been like back home. From what I hear it's been pretty coooooold. But any of the lock and dams would be a good place to look as there should still be some open water.
